Tater and Spud were the best cops in Yamville. They arrested more criminals than any other officer and more importantly, they were cool dudes. The pair were on top of the world when tragedy struck one year ago. The cops were in pursuit of The Leprechaun, a dangerous bank robber who had evaded capture for months. Tater and Spud were assigned to the case. Little did they know that it would be their last as a team.






The Leprechaun (real name Paddy O'Reilly) was Ireland's most notorious criminal. He was on the Most Wanted List of every international police agency. He fled Ireland a couple of years ago and resumed his life of crime in Yamville. The local police force came close to capturing him but the insidious Irishman was always one step ahead of them. He definitely had the luck of the Irish. Detectives Tater and Spud were relentless in their pursuit of the bad guy. Eventually they were able to corner him at an old fast food restaurant. The building was surrounded by police. There was no way out for the smooth criminal.



FOZZIE'S BURGERS



"Nice work boys" Sarge said as he patted the Tater on the back. "We've got him surrounded. There's no way out for The Leprechaun this time. Where's your partner Tater?" "He was here a minute ago. Oh no! I think he went inside to confront The Leprechaun." "I love his enthusiasm but he's hard to control at times." "Alright Tater, we'll keep The Leprechaun occupied while you sneak around back and arrest him." "I'm on it Sarge!" Tater went around back and climbed through an open window.












"Put the gun down copper. I surrender. It looks as if long last you've finally captured me. Or have you?" The Leprechaun taunted the detective. "You have quite a big decision to make. Either you can arrest me now or save your partner." "What are you talking about?" "Your partner tried to be the hero but I set a little trap for him." "Where is he?" Detective Tater screamed. "You can find him by the deep fryers. He should golden brown by now." "NO!" Tater shouted as he shoved the Irishman to the ground.











"Spud? Oh no! What happened?" "I was pushed into a deep fryer. I don't have much longer. You were the best partner a potato could ask for." "Hang in there Spud. Help is on the way." "It's too late for me but not for you. Promise me that you will stop The Leprechaun once and for all." "I will. We will. Spud?" Sadly, Spud succumbed to his injuries. "No! It's not fair. C'mon buddy! Open your eyes!" "He's gone Tater" Sarge said as he fought back tears. "I will not rest until I have avenged my partner's death. And nobody is going to stop me!" "You're a cop Tater. Your job is to serve and protect. Not to take the law into your own hands."












Losing his best friend and partner had a serious effect on Tater. He was a good cop who always obeyed the law. But now the cool cop had become a hot head who often argued with his fellow officers "Tater, I need to see you in my office" Sarge beckoned. "I know that you're still grieving for Spud. We all are. But we can't tolerate your behavior any longer. I'm going to have to suspend you indefinitely. Please hand in your water pistol and badge." "What about The Leprechaun? He's still out there!" "And we'll catch him eventually. This is too personal for you and it would only jeopardize our case." Tater stormed out and would've slammed the door if he had arms.







SPUD

The suspension was actually a blessing in disguise for Tater. He could now focus all of his energy on finding The Leprechaun and bringing him to justice. The fact that he didn't have to obey any laws made his quest for revenge even more appealing. It was time for Tater to do things his way. He had always been the ideal officer and a good citizen. But not anymore. This time it was personal. Every day since he lost his friend, Tater visited him at the local cemetery. He found courage and strength that he didn't know he had. "Don't worry my friend. I will avenge your death. As for The Leprechaun, let's just say that his luck is about to run out."


MICKEY'S PUB
ST. PATRICK'S DAY PARTY!


One evening while cruising around town, Tater came across a raucous Irish Pub. "I totally forgot about St. Patrick's Day. If anyone would know where I can find The Leprechaun it would be these lads." Tater headed inside the bar to find people laughing, dancing, and singing. "What'll be Mac?" the bartender asked. "I'll have a Fresca." "You mean green beer?" the man responded with a look of disgust. "Oh sorry. I meant to say a green beer." Tater took his glass of beer and began to survey the bar for people to talk to. He soon made eye contact with another patron and headed over to a darkened corner of the pub.
